Karen Harp

Karen has been learning the harp since the age of 4 from her mother, who is also a harpist. After her O Levels, she decided to study Music and enrolled in the Nanyang Academy of Fine Arts School Of Music, majoring in harp performance. She is currently under the tutelage of Ms Huang Yu-Hsin.

Some of her achievements include being the first Singaporean to be a Finalist in the Emerging Artist (up to 19) category in the Young Artist Harp Competition 2016, held in Georgia, USA. Other competitions include the First Asian Harp Chamber Competition 2015 in Singapore, where she attained a Distinction award as part of a harp duo, and recently she participated in the 28th Nippon Harp Competition in Soka, Japan. In school, she is the recipient of the Teresa Hsu Scholarship.

Karen has performed with the NAFA Orchestra, re:mix and The Philharmonic Orchestra. She was the harp soloist for the Bruch’s Scottish Fantasy for Violin, Harp and Orchestra, performed by re:mix at their 10th anniversary concert in 2016.

Karen has been performing for weddings and corporate events since the age of 8. At present, she is the resident harpist at The Fullerton Hotel, Singapore.
